我正在尝试将我的正则表达式放在资源XML文件中。解析我的 XML 文件时,它会引发异常并使应用程序崩溃。
(^(?!'s)(?!.*'s's)[ A-Za-z0-9'-]{1,35}(?<!'s)$)
我在这里错过了任何转义序列吗?否则,什么会导致崩溃?
将您的正则表达式包含在<![CDATA[(^(?!'s)(?!.*'s's)[ A-Za-z0-9'-]{1,35}(?<!'s)$)]]>
这将使里面的文本不会被解释为 xml。
我正在尝试将我的正则表达式放在资源XML文件中。解析我的 XML 文件时,它会引发异常并使应用程序崩溃。
(^(?!'s)(?!.*'s's)[ A-Za-z0-9'-]{1,35}(?<!'s)$)
我在这里错过了任何转义序列吗?否则,什么会导致崩溃?
将您的正则表达式包含在<![CDATA[(^(?!'s)(?!.*'s's)[ A-Za-z0-9'-]{1,35}(?<!'s)$)]]>
这将使里面的文本不会被解释为 xml。